KillerShell at a glance

KillerShell is an open-source Windows utility that combines a file browser, terminal, and text editor within a single window and tab strip. It targets system administrators and field technicians who need to move quickly between file management, command-line access, and text editing without juggling several separate applications. An included admin toolkit adds process and service management, event log viewing, a registry editor, and live performance monitoring.

The application ships as a single self-contained executable with no external runtime dependency and can be run either installed or in a fully portable mode. There is no background service or indexing component, keeping idle resource usage low. Updates are published irregularly through GitHub releases as new executable builds.

When updating, administrators should note whether a portable deployment is in use, since portable copies must be replaced manually, whereas the installed variant can surface update notifications. As this is a solo-developer project, it is advisable to review the release notes and test new builds before wider rollout, particularly for environments relying on the portable executable across multiple machines.
